Output 98ec26d88cd24b0c22969b23822ef12affcba71166b2d1479f0cd81e4a07a94f:1

value
5580474
script pubkey
OP_0 OP_PUSHBYTES_20 076959e0b94398351b19783c41686b54281e7e44
address
bc1qqa54nc9egwvr2xce0q7yz6rt2s5puljyhxlau9
transaction
98ec26d88cd24b0c22969b23822ef12affcba71166b2d1479f0cd81e4a07a94f
spent
true